Job description
Overview

The EPR Infrastructure Manager will lead the team responsible for the EPR estates maintenance and support, ensuring optimal performance and availability of the EPR system. This role involves strategic planning, team management, and collaboration across technical and application teams to maintain a robust infrastructure that aligns with organisational objectives. The role is critical for ensuring the stability, performance, and security of the server estate supporting the EPR system and contributing to the Trust's healthcare initiatives.

Responsibilities
  • Lead and manage the team responsible for server estate deployment, maintenance, and support within the EPR Infrastructure unit.
  • Oversee the design, configuration, deployment, and maintenance of server and database environments supporting EPR applications, ensuring high availability and performance.
  • Collaborate with the BI team and other stakeholders to ensure seamless integration between the database and server infrastructures.
  • Develop and implement server and database deployment strategies in alignment with trust growth plans and project initiatives.
  • Lead the team on proactively monitoring server and database environments, identifying and addressing performance bottlenecks and potential issues to maintain optimal system performance.
  • Engage in capacity planning exercises to ensure server and database resources meet the Trust's requirements and facilitate scalability.
  • Lead disaster recovery planning and failover/fallback exercises for the Epic infrastructure, ensuring timely recovery in case of failures and minimizing data loss.
  • Collaborate with vendors, technical teams, and end-users to troubleshoot Epic Infrastructure incidents and problems, and implement solutions.
  • Define, document, and enforce server and database support policies, guidelines, and procedures, ensuring adherence to industry best practices and ITIL standards.
About us

We are ESNEFT and we provide hospital and community health services to almost one million people across east Suffolk and north Essex. Our dedicated staff deliver care from acute hospitals in Colchester and Ipswich, community hospitals, surgeries, community clinics and in patients' own homes.

We are one of the largest NHS organisations in England, employing more than 12,000 staff.

We pride ourselves on supporting our staff. We offer a wide range of training and development opportunities, as well as flexible working options.

Along with supporting you to achieve your career goals we offer a generous pension scheme, unsocial hours payments (where applicable), 27 days annual leave on commencement (pro rata) and access to a range of NHS discounts. Our Staff Health and Wellbeing programme offer a variety of services.

Our philosophy is that Time Matters to everyone. Across the Trust, we concentrate on improving the things we do and removing those which cause time delays for our staff and patients.

We are investing in our commitment to Time Matters with a partnership with leading electronic patient record (EPR) supplier Epic. This digital transformation will bring what's widely regarded as the world's best EPR system to ESNEFT, transforming life in hospital for staff and patients.
